Hey peeps, I have a couple of cherry shrimp and finally going to start the breeding to use as food source for the large puff (I know I am mean loL). I have a 96 litre set up with lots of live plants and mass of java moss, heated, lighted and filtered. The other occupants will be some bumblebee gobies, I am not sure how prolific eaters they are, but how many to get to try and get loads of cherry shrimp spawning? Also I know the shrimp eat veggies, but I mainly have bottom food pellets, flake and some shrimp pellets, is this good?
 
They should do fine on prepared food. Just make sure that the young have a place to shelter. Young shrimp are extremely tiny and just about anything will like to eat them. As long as you have both male and female shrimps and in the conditions right, they will breed like mad :lol: 10 will be a good number to ensure you have both sexes. Food-wise, you can feed them algae wafers, flakes, pellets, frozen bloodworms, brine shrimps, boiled organic veggies, etc... They are not too fussy really but obviously more vegetation content is prefered.
